- The distance between Puerto Aysen, Chile and Wilkes-Barre-Scranton, Pa, Usa is approximately 9,649 km or 5,996 mi.
- To reach Puerto Aysen in this distance one would set out from Wilkes-Barre-Scranton, Pa bearing 177.9° or S and follow the great circles arc to approach Puerto Aysen bearing 177.7° or S .
- Puerto Aysen has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Wilkes-Barre-Scranton, Pa has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- Puerto Aysen is in or near the cool temperate rain forest biome whereas Wilkes-Barre-Scranton, Pa is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 0.5 °C (0.9°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.5 °C (29.7°F) less in Puerto Aysen.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1728.1 mm (68 in) more which is equivalent to 1728.1 l/m² (42.41 US gal/ft²) or 17,281,000 l/ha (1,847,454 US gal/ac) more. About 2 7/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 4.8° lower in Puerto Aysen than in Wilkes-Barre-Scranton, Pa.
